A spotlight in the Asia Pacific agricultural market

Add to favorites
The Asia Pacific (APAC) agricultural biologicals market is valued at USD 4.6 billion (~Euro 3.96 billion), based on a five-year historical analysis. This growth is mainly driven by rising awareness of environmental concerns, consumers’ increasing demand for sustainable agricultural practices, and the need for effective pest management solutions (Ken Research, 2025).

The APAC region is increasingly getting warmer, and nearly twice as fast as the global average. 2024 was recorded to be one of the hottest years on record for the region (WMO, 2025).

By 2030, Asia is projected to experience a regional temperature increase of around 0.5-2° C in addition to a global sea level rise of approximately 3-16 centimetres (AASA, 2012). Rising temperatures have been linked to an increased amount of greenhouse gases. In addition, potentially more intense tropical cyclones and changes in climate variability, such as El Niño, are expected to be present (AASA, 2012). Last year, the La Niña event and the worsening spread of bird flu impacted crop and livestock production. The worsening bird flu virus affects millions of wild birds and commercial poultry, hundreds of dairy cattle herds, and dozens of humans (Zimmerman, Owens, 2025), making climate change the foremost threat to Asia’s sustainable development . With Southeast Asia region, the most vulnerable to climate change due to the densely populated cities and geographic exposure with coastal zones, which makes the risk of sea-level rise more prominent for the region (Putra, 2024).

Climate change continues to have a notable impact on farming, with extreme weather conditions such as heatwaves and floods becoming more common and severe. What does this mean for agriculture?

Soil system

GettyImages-691338102-Edited_cuzkpw
The soil system is an integral part of the land environment (Mohamed, at el., 1998), composed of soil constituents, water, and air, it is the living environment from which humans, animals, and plants extract most of their food and energy. The Asia Pacific region hosts 50% of the world’s arable land, which is vital to the global food supply (World Bank 2024a).

Healthy soil systems are more compact and essential than you realise. A healthy soil system is vital for agriculture and food security, biodiversity and ecosystems, and populations (Correia et al., 2025). Healthy soil captures and stores more carbon, which reduces the amount of carbon dioxide in the atmosphere, helping slow global warming.

Agricultural areas are extremely vulnerable to droughts and sea level rise. Erratic rainfall and soil degradation harm agricultural production. Coastal areas face salinisation from rising sea levels, while inland areas face droughts and heatwaves that reduce crop yields (Chakravarty, P., 2025). Drought causes soil to dry out and lose nutritional value, while higher temperatures mean faster decomposition of organic matter – releasing carbon. The interconnected pressures of climate change, population growth, excess chemical fertiliser and pesticide use, and intensive agricultural production is contributing to widespread land depletion and degradation (Correia et al., 2025). Poor soil quality lacks the nutrients a crop needs for production, resulting in lower yields for farmers.

Soil challenges

  • Soil erosion
Soil erosion occurs when there is a quick loss of the topsoil, as a result of soil particles being detached and removed (UNDRR, 2023). When that happens, it can affect infiltration and drainage in the soil, which poses a significant hazard to soil, depleting nutrient rich topsoil.

  • Soil pollution
Soil pollution refers to the contamination of soil with waste materials of human origin, leading to concentrations that are higher than average and have harmful effects on both human health and ecosystems (Münzel et al., 2022). This contamination can include heavy metals, toxic organic chemicals such as pesticides, biological pathogens, and deforestation.
